> > > this series switches the x86 code the the dma-direct implementation
> > > for direct (non-iommu) dma and the generic swiotlb ops.  This includes
> > > getting rid of the special ops for the AMD memory encryption case and
> > > the STA2x11 SOC.  The generic implementations are based on the x86
> > > code, so they provide the same functionality.
